Someone with the SWG in the desert local climate will take advantage of an increased CYA volume of around 80 PPM with regards to UV protection as well as the more info here CYA Doing work array. It's essential to account for as much as 10 PPM CYA month-to-month degradation in these climates. Commencing increased will give you much more buffer until finally the pool begins behaving oddly.

CYA not only shields chlorine from UV decline, but Additionally, it acts for a chlorine buffer. The Lively chlorine species (hypochlorous acid and hypochlorite anion) are stored at Substantially lower concentrations by holding the chlorine atom in reserve by reversibly bonding with it. Though this buffering chemistry slows down oxidation and disinfection, it can help keep chlorine amounts manageable and fewer severe into the pores and skin, eyes, hair, bathing suits, and so on.
